Covering part of Waupaca County, Wisconsin, ZIP Code 54949 has about 3,549 residents. The median household income of $84,286 is above the Waupaca County median ($71,189).
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 54949's population grew 5.0% from 3,379 to 3,549, while its median gross rent rose 19.1% from $701 to $835.
13.1% of adults 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. Owners occupy 76.7% of the area's occupied homes.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 3,379 | $60,676 | $142,800 | $701 |
| 2020 | 3,271 | $65,375 | $150,800 | $711 |
| 2021 | 3,438 | $72,619 | $159,300 | $720 |
| 2022 | 3,341 | $76,975 | $179,700 | $765 |
| 2023 | 3,549 | $84,286 | $192,200 | $835 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
